Picking the Right Skylight





Selecting the right skylight is an important action in improving both the aesthetic and functional aspects of your area. Skylight Installation in Cleveland Heights. The selection procedure entails numerous essential aspects, consisting of the kind, dimension, and material of the skylight, as well as its energy effectiveness ratings


There are different types of skylights available, such as repaired, aired vent, and tubular skylights, each serving different objectives. Repaired skylights are perfect for all-natural lighting, while vented choices enable for airflow, adding to much better indoor air top quality. Tubular skylights are particularly efficient in smaller sized spaces, carrying light from the roofing down into the interior.


The size of the skylight must be proportionate to the room and its existing frameworks, making certain an optimal balance of light without frustrating the area. Furthermore, consider the product and glazing options. Low-E or double-glazed glass can considerably boost thermal efficiency and decrease energy expenses by lessening warm loss throughout colder months.


Preparing Your Roofing System Structure



Before setup, it's important to guarantee that your roofing structure is properly prepared to support the brand-new skylight. Begin by evaluating the existing roofing system framing to verify it satisfies the lots requirements for the skylight you have picked. Depending upon the size and design, additional assistance might be needed to stop architectural failing.


Following, inspect the roof covering product and underlying elements for any kind of indications of damage or degeneration. Any compromised areas need to be fixed or changed to make sure a secure structure for the skylight installment. Furthermore, take into consideration the pitch of your roofing; a steeper incline might need specific flashing techniques to protect against leaks.


Examine local structure codes and policies to make certain compliance with any needs connected to skylight installments, as this can affect both safety and security and energy efficiency. Proper preparation will boost the long life and performance of your skylight, maximizing its energy-saving capacity.


Installation Strategies for Skylights



Effective installment techniques for skylights are essential to ensuring their appropriate capability and longevity (Cleveland Heights Roof Maintenance). First, it is vital to pick the ideal area for the skylight, considering factors such as roofing system pitch, sunlight exposure, and possible blockages. When the area is identified, careful measurements need to be taken to produce an accurate opening in the roofing system


Before reducing, ensure the roofing framework can support the skylight's weight. Use a power saw to cut the roofing system opening, guaranteeing the sides are smooth and complimentary from splinters. Next off, install a curb or frame around the open up to supply a strong base for the skylight and to assist in appropriate drainage.


When positioning the skylight, straighten it with the curb and protect it using appropriate bolts. It's critical to comply with the manufacturer's standards regarding the spacing and sort of fasteners made use of. After protecting the skylight, check for degree and plumb alignment.

Maintenance Tips for Power Effectiveness



Sustaining energy efficiency in your skylight calls for an aggressive technique to maintenance that attends to both performance and longevity. Normal assessments are necessary; check for signs of water condensation, mold and mildew, or leakage. Pay special focus to the seals and flashing, as these locations are essential for avoiding drafts and moisture intrusion.


Cleansing the glass surface area is similarly essential; dust and particles can dramatically minimize all-natural light transmission, consequently impacting your home's power effectiveness. Utilize a gentle, non-abrasive cleaner to prevent harming the surface area. Additionally, inspect and clean up the interior and exterior components, such as the framework websites and any type of operable parts, to guarantee smooth capability.


Consider seasonal maintenance checks, specifically after harsh climate condition, to identify any prospective concerns before they intensify. Make sure that the skylight is properly protected and that the bordering roof covering area is in good condition.


Lastly, if your skylight features operable ventilation, guarantee that the devices are operating properly to advertise air flow and decrease interior humidity levels. Normal upkeep not just enhances energy effectiveness yet likewise extends the life of your skylight, providing long-term value to your home.
